Abstract

Disclosed herewith is a staff type golf bag. The staff type golf bag includes a bag body shaped in the form of a hollow cylinder. The bag body includes a skin assembly, which is comprised of a skin body provided with a pocket, a top band arranged on the upper portion of the skin body, and a bottom strip arranged on the lower portion of the skin body. The bag body further includes a reinforcing plate that has a size corresponding to the size of the skin assembly. The reinforcing plate is fixedly attached to the rear surface of the skin assembly. A bottom support is fixedly attached under the bottom strip to the bottom portion of the bag body. A top mold is fixedly attached under the top band to the top portion of the bag body.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A staff type golf bag, comprising: 
 a skin assembly comprised of, 
 a skin body provided with a pocket,  
 a top band arranged on an upper portion of said skin body, and  
 a bottom strip arranged on a lower portion of said skin body; and  
   a reinforcing plate having a size corresponding to a size of said skin assembly;    wherein said skin assembly is laid on and fixedly attached to said reinforcing plate;    wherein said reinforcing plate forms a cylindrical shape with both side ends of said reinforcing plate connected to each other by connection means.    
     
     
         2 . The staff type golf bag according to  claim 1 , wherein said connection means is a slide fastener, a Velcro tape, or staples.  
     
     
         3 . The staff type golf bag according to  claim 1 , wherein said reinforcing plate is provided on its one side or both sides with a plurality of corrugations.  
     
     
         4 . A staff type golf bag, comprising a skin body opened through its rear pocket, a top band attached to an upper portion of said skin body, a bottom strip attached to a lower portion of said skin body, and a reinforcing plate situated inside of said skin body, characterized in that: 
 said skin body, said top band and said bottom strip, which are integrated into a skin assembly, are fixedly attached to said reinforcing plate;    both side ends of said reinforcing plate are connected to each other by connection means to form a cylindrical body; and    both side ends of said skin body are connected to each other by a slide fastener attached to said rear pocket.    
     
     
         5 . The staff type golf bag according to  claim 4 , wherein said connection means is a slide fastener, a Velcro tape, or staples.  
     
     
         6 . A staff type golf bag, comprising a skin body open vertically, a top band attached to an upper portion of said skin body, a bottom strip attached to a lower portion of said skin body, and a reinforcing plate situated inside of said skin body, characterized in that: 
 said skin body, said top band and said bottom strip, which are integrated into a skin assembly, are fixedly attached to said reinforcing plate;    both side ends of said reinforcing plate are connected to each other by a slide or Velcro fastener to form a cylindrical body; and    both side ends of said skin body are connected to each other by a slide fastener or thread.
